Personnalisé PHP Export Excel
Est quelqu'un de connaissance d'une méthode pour exporter des champs spécifiques à partir d'une base de données personnalisée avec des titres de colonne dans excel à partir de MSQL utilisant PHP?
Où il n'y a de ressources sur cette?
- stackoverflow.com/search?q=generate+excel+file+%5Bphp%5D
- Doit être en format excel ou CSV est assez bon?
- doit être au format excel unfortunetly...
- une bonne csv suffirait pour que le temps bien
- Malheureusement, Excel 2010 dans Win 7 n'est plus possible d'ouvrir les fichiers avec l' .extension xls si elles sont au format texte délimité par des tabulations ou CSV. Les mêmes fichiers que le téléchargement très bien sur mon XP ou Vista n'est pas ouvert à tous sur mon Win7 ordinateur.
Vous devez vous connecter pour publier un commentaire.
Excel sera heureux de lire un fichier CSV comme une feuille de calcul. CSV est juste un format de texte, afin de créer du texte et de l'écho avec le contenu approprié-type:
"
en""
, qui est ce que le code il n'.header("Content-Disposition: attachment; filename=something.xls");
À l'aide de la PHPExcel bibliothèque:
À l'aide de PHPExcel, vous pouvez également ajouter une mise en forme, ou de créer des classeurs avec plusieurs feuilles de calcul, etc
Viens de faire un select sur les champs que vous voulez, et en sortie les résultats avec des champs séparés par des virgules, et chaque ligne sur sa propre ligne. Idéalement, devrait devrait entourer chaque valeur avec des guillemets, et
addslashes()
pour échapper à toutes les citations dans les données.La sortie de la suite et de les enregistrer dans un fichier avec un nom se terminant en
.csv
, et de l'ouvrir dans Excel.